*cough* WHAT?!

Watching the Daytona 500… It’s Toyota’s debut in the Nextel Cup series… Funny thing is, out of all the manufacturers – Chevy, Dodge, Ford… Toyota is the only manufacturer who actually builds its vehicles in the US.

Speaks volumes.

This entry was posted in Ramblings.... Bookmark the permalink.

Leave a Reply

Your email address will not be published. Required fields are marked *